Apache HttpComponents Client

Screenshot Λογισμικό:
Apache HttpComponents Client
Στοιχεία Λογισμικού:
Εκδοχή: 4.5.1 επικαιροποιημένο
Ανεβάστε ημερομηνία: 6 Mar 16
Προγραμματιστής: Apache Software Foundation
Άδεια: Δωρεάν
Δημοτικότητα: 58

Rating: nan/5 (Total Votes: 0)

Apache HttpComponents Πελάτης είναι ο διάδοχος του τα ευρέως χρησιμοποιούμενα Τζακάρτα Commons httpclient 3.1 και είναι στενά συνδεδεμένη με την Apache HttpComponents πυρήνα βιβλιοθήκη.

Η βιβλιοθήκη πελάτη HttpComponents είναι ένα εργαλείο που προορίζεται για την επέκταση της Java ενσωματωμένη υποστήριξη για διάφορες λειτουργίες HTTP που σχετίζονται με την παροχή επιπλέον χαρακτηριστικά που σχετίζονται με την πιστοποίηση, τη σύνδεση και τη διαχείριση των cookies.

Αυτό βοηθά προγραμματιστής πολύ όταν την οικοδόμηση HTTP-ολοκληρωμένα προγράμματα λογισμικού και εφαρμογών, ιδίως δεδομένου ότι η βιβλιοθήκη είναι αγνωστικιστής περιεχόμενο και μπορεί να χρησιμοποιηθεί για ένα ευρύ σύνολο εργαλείων.

httpclient συμμορφώνεται με τις ακόλουθες προδιαγραφές:

* RFC 1945 Hypertext Transfer Protocol - HTTP / 1.0

* RFC 2616 Hypertext Transfer Protocol - HTTP / 1.1

* RFC 2109 Μηχανισμός HTTP μέλος Διαχείρισης (Cookies)

* RFC 2965 Μηχανισμός HTTP μέλος Διαχείρισης (v2 Cookies)

* RFC 2617 HTTP Authentication: Βασική και Digest πρόσβασης ταυτότητας

Τι είναι καινούργιο σε αυτήν την έκδοση:

    < li> httpclient 4.3.4 (GA) είναι μια απελευθέρωση συντήρησης που βελτιώνει την απόδοση σε υψηλές σενάρια ταυτοχρονισμού.
  • Αυτή η έκδοση αντικαθιστά δυναμική πληρεξούσια με μαθήματα προσαρμοσμένα μεσολάβησης και εξαλείφει τον ισχυρισμό νήμα σε java.reflect.Proxy.newInstance () όταν χρηματοδοτικής μίσθωσης συνδέσεις από τους πισίνα σύνδεση και την ανταπόκριση επεξεργασία μηνυμάτων.

Τι είναι καινούργιο στην έκδοση 4.5:

  • httpclient 4.3.4 (GA) είναι μια απελευθέρωση συντήρησης που βελτιώνει την απόδοση σε υψηλές σενάρια ταυτοχρονισμού.
  • Αυτή η έκδοση αντικαθιστά δυναμική πληρεξούσια με μαθήματα προσαρμοσμένα μεσολάβησης και εξαλείφει τον ισχυρισμό νήμα σε java.reflect.Proxy.newInstance () όταν χρηματοδοτικής μίσθωσης συνδέσεις από τους πισίνα σύνδεση και την ανταπόκριση επεξεργασία μηνυμάτων.

Τι είναι καινούργιο στην έκδοση 4.4.1:

  • httpclient 4.3.4 (GA) είναι ένας συντήρησης αποδέσμευσης που βελτιώνει την απόδοση σε υψηλές σενάρια ταυτοχρονισμού.
  • Αυτή η έκδοση αντικαθιστά δυναμική πληρεξούσια με μαθήματα προσαρμοσμένα μεσολάβησης και εξαλείφει τον ισχυρισμό νήμα σε java.reflect.Proxy.newInstance () όταν χρηματοδοτικής μίσθωσης συνδέσεις από τους πισίνα σύνδεση και την ανταπόκριση επεξεργασία μηνυμάτων.

Τι είναι καινούργιο στην έκδοση 4.4:

  • httpclient 4.3.4 (GA) είναι μια απελευθέρωση συντήρησης που βελτιώνει την απόδοση σε υψηλές σενάρια ταυτοχρονισμού.
  • Αυτή η έκδοση αντικαθιστά δυναμική πληρεξούσια με μαθήματα προσαρμοσμένα μεσολάβησης και εξαλείφει τον ισχυρισμό νήμα σε java.reflect.Proxy.newInstance () όταν χρηματοδοτικής μίσθωσης συνδέσεις από τους πισίνα σύνδεση και την ανταπόκριση επεξεργασία μηνυμάτων.

Τι είναι καινούργιο στην έκδοση 4.3-beta1:

  • Υποστήριξη για Java 7 δοκιμή-με-πόρους για την διαχείριση των πόρων (δελτίο σύνδεσης.)
  • Προστέθηκε άπταιστα τάξεις Builder για HttpEntity, HttpRequest και httpclient περιπτώσεις.
  • Απόρριψης της προτίμησης και API διαμόρφωση με βάση HttpParams διασύνδεση υπέρ της ένεσης κατασκευαστή και απλά αντικείμενα ρυθμίσεων.
  • Η εξάρτηση από αμετάβλητο αντικείμενο αντί για το συγχρονισμό πρόσβασης για την ασφάλεια νήμα. Αρκετά παλιά τάξεις των οποίων περιπτώσεις μπορεί να μοιραστεί με πολλαπλές ανταλλαγές αίτησης έχουν αντικατασταθεί από αμετάβλητο ισοδύναμα.

  • Οι
  • DefaultHttpClient, DecompressingHttpClient, CachingHttpClient και παρόμοιες κατηγορίες καταργηθεί υπέρ των τάξεων οικοδόμος που παράγουν αμετάβλητο περιπτώσεις httpclient.

Τι είναι καινούργιο στην έκδοση 4.2.1:

  • Αυτή είναι μια απελευθέρωση bug fix που αντιμετωπίζει μια σειρά των θεμάτων που αναφέρθηκαν μετά την κυκλοφορία 4.2.

Τι είναι καινούργιο στην έκδοση 4.2:

  • Νέα πρόσοψη API για httpclient βασίζεται στην έννοια της άπταιστα interface. Η άπταιστα API εκθέτει μόνο τις πιο θεμελιώδεις λειτουργίες της httpclient και προορίζεται για σχετικά απλές περιπτώσεις χρήσης που δεν απαιτούν την πλήρη ευελιξία της httpclient. Ωστόσο, η άπταιστα API απαλλάσσει σχεδόν πλήρως τους χρήστες από το να ασχοληθεί με τη διαχείριση σύνδεσης και ανακατανομή των πόρων.
  • επανασχεδιαστεί και ξαναγράφεται κώδικα διαχείρισης της σύνδεσης.

Τι είναι καινούργιο στην έκδοση 4.1.3:

  • Αυτή είναι μια απελευθέρωση bug fix που αντιμετωπίζει μια σειρά των θεμάτων που βρέθηκαν θέματα από το 4.1.2 κυρίως στη μονάδα HTTP caching.

Τι είναι καινούργιο στην έκδοση 4.2-α1:.

  • επανασχεδιαστεί και ξαναγράφεται κώδικα διαχείρισης σύνδεσης
  • Νέα πρόσοψη API για httpclient βασίζεται στην έννοια της άπταιστα διεπαφή.
  • Ενισχυμένη HTTP API ελέγχου ταυτότητας που επιτρέπει httpclient να χειριστεί πιο σύνθετα σενάρια ελέγχου ταυτότητας.

Τι είναι καινούργιο στην έκδοση 4.1.2:

  • Αυτή είναι μια απελευθέρωση bug fix που αντιμετωπίζει μια σειρά μη-κρίσιμα ζητήματα που αναφέρθηκαν μετά την κυκλοφορία 4.1.1.

Τι είναι καινούργιο στην έκδοση 4.1.1:

  • HttpHostConnectException δεν σωστά επαναληφθεί για άμεση και μη-τούνελ συνδέσεις μεσολάβησης.
  • αλλάξει τον τρόπο URIUtils # rewriteURI χειρίζεται πολλαπλές συνεχόμενες καθέτους στο στοιχείο διαδρομής URI: πολλαπλές οδηγεί καθέτους θα αντικατασταθεί από ένα κάθετο, προκειμένου να αποφευχθεί η σύγχυση με το συστατικό αρχή. Το υπόλοιπο περιεχόμενο της διαδρομής δεν θα τροποποιηθεί.
  • Σταθερά κρίσιμη bug που προκαλεί Εξουσιοδότηση διακομιστή μεσολάβησης κεφαλίδα που θα σταλεί στον στόχο υποδοχής όταν tunneling αιτήματα μέσω ενός διακομιστή μεσολάβησης που απαιτεί έλεγχο ταυτότητας.
  • Διορθώθηκε bug που προκαλεί το αναχαίτισης πρωτόκολλο RequestAuthCache να δημιουργήσει μια μη έγκυρη παράδειγμα AuthScope όταν αναζητούν τα διαπιστευτήρια του χρήστη για προτίμησης ταυτότητας.
  • Διορθώθηκε ο τρόπος DigestScheme παράγει αξίες nonce-καταμέτρηση.

Τι είναι καινούργιο στην έκδοση 4.0.3:

  • httpclient 4.0.2 είναι μια απελευθέρωση συντήρησης που διορθώνει μια σειρά από σφάλματα που ανακαλύφθηκε από την προηγούμενη σταθερή έκδοση. Αυτό είναι πιθανό να είναι η τελευταία έκδοση από το υποκατάστημα 4.0.x.

Τι είναι καινούργιο στην έκδοση 4.1 Alpha 1:

  • SO_TIMEOUT δεν έχει μηδενιστεί για τους έμμονους (επαναχρησιμοποιηθούν ) συνδέσεις.
  • Εκτεταμένη χειρισμό interface ανακατεύθυνσης πελάτη για να επιτρέψει τον έλεγχο του περιεχομένου της ανακατεύθυνσης.
  • Υποστήριξη για το σύστημα ελέγχου ταυτότητας SPNEGO.
  • Προστέθηκε παραμέτρους για να καθορίσει τη σειρά προτίμησης για τα υποστηριζόμενα συστήματα auth για στόχο υποδοχής και ελέγχου ταυτότητας διακομιστή μεσολάβησης.
  • Διαφανής περιεχόμενο υποστήριξης κωδικοποίηση.

Τι είναι καινούργιο στην έκδοση 4.0.1:.

  • Αφαιρέθηκε η εξάρτηση από jcip-annotations.jar
  • SO_TIMEOUT δεν έχει μηδενιστεί για τους έμμονους (επαναχρησιμοποιούνται) συνδέσεις.
  • UrlEncodedFormEntity θέτει τώρα charset στην επικεφαλίδα Content-Type.
  • Αποκλεισμός αναζητήσεις Σύνδεση βραχύβια αντικείμενα αλλοιώνοντας απόδοση.
  • URLEncodedUtils αναλύει τώρα σωστά οντότητες μορφή-url-κωδικοποιημένα που καθορίζουν ένα σύνολο χαρακτήρων.

Παρόμοια λογισμικά

CiscoConfParse
CiscoConfParse

19 Jul 15

IPy
IPy

11 Apr 15

Requests
Requests

12 May 15

Άλλο λογισμικό του προγραμματιστή Apache Software Foundation

Apache Axis
Apache Axis

5 Jun 15

Apache Flume
Apache Flume

4 Jun 15

Apache Abdera
Apache Abdera

13 Apr 15

Apache Neethi
Apache Neethi

13 Apr 15

Σχόλια για Apache HttpComponents Client

Τα σχόλια δεν βρέθηκε
προσθήκη σχολίου
Ενεργοποιήστε τις εικόνες!
Αναζήτηση ανά κατηγορία